Historical Context: The Roots of Tabletop Gaming
Originating in the early 20th century, games like Chess and Checkers laid the groundwork for strategic thinking, while the mid-century explosion of Dungeons & Dragons in the 1970s revolutionised storytelling and character-based gameplay. As industry data indicates, the global tabletop gaming market generated over $12 billion in 2020, demonstrating resilience and growth despite digital competition (ICv2, 2021).
The Digital Shift: Enhancing Traditional Play
Advances in technology have tremendously transformed how players engage with tabletop games. The advent of virtual tabletops such as Roll20 and Fantasy Grounds has allowed remote gaming, bringing together diverse communities. This transition was accelerated by the COVID-19 pandemic, which saw a 50% surge in online tabletop sessions, underscoring how digital tools complement and extend traditional play.

Emerging Trends and Future Directions
| Trend | Description | Impact |
|---|---|---|
| Digital-Physical Hybrid Games | Combining physical game components with digital apps via QR codes or AR | Increases accessibility and redefines gameplay possibilities |
| Artificial Intelligence | Custom game masters and adaptive narratives powered by AI | Personalises experiences, making complex scenarios achievable for solo players |
| Crowdsourced Content | User-generated campaigns and mechanics shared online | Fosters community-driven innovation and diversity in game design |
